Useful english expressions

...click to see translation


To spend time with...


Pasar tiempo con...


To hang out with...

Pasar el rato relajadamente con...


To hang around with...


Juntarse con...



To be "in touch" with somebody

Estar "en contacto" con alguien



Workmate


Compañero de trabajo



To share common interests

Tener cosas en común o los mismos intereses


...with each other


...juntos o mutuamente


To stay home


Quedarse en casa
